Machine learning models are not static; their performance can weaken as data evolves. That’s why model retraining has become a cornerstone of modern MLOps, ensuring systems remain accurate, relevant, and adaptable. In this post, we’ll explore what retraining means, why it matters, the strategies behind it, and how to apply best practices to keep models strong over time.
What Does Model Retraining Mean?
At its core, retraining is the process of building a fresh version of a model by running the training workflow again with updated data. This cycle helps the model reflect new patterns and behaviors that emerge in the real world. Without it, models risk degradation due to two common issues:
- Data drift: When the statistical makeup of incoming data shifts—such as changes in distribution or variance—the model’s earlier assumptions become less effective.
- Concept drift: When the relationship between features and outcomes evolves, the model’s original mapping no longer captures reality as accurately.
Both drifts erode predictive quality, making retraining an essential safeguard.
Why Should We Retrain Models?
Retraining has two central goals:
- Preserve Accuracy
As data and concepts change, predictions may become unreliable. Retraining re-aligns the model with the latest trends, keeping its performance consistent. - Incorporate New Information
Fresh training data brings exposure to emerging scenarios. By including these examples, models gain adaptability and can handle real-world cases more effectively.
Common Retraining Strategies
Organizations generally follow one of two approaches:
- Time-based retraining: Models are updated at fixed intervals, such as weekly or monthly. This method is simple to schedule but may lag behind sudden changes.
- Event-driven retraining: Here, retraining is triggered by alerts when performance metrics fall below a threshold or when data patterns shift noticeably. While more complex to implement, it is faster at adapting to new conditions.
Key Triggers for Retraining
Monitoring the right signals is vital in event-driven workflows. Useful triggers include:
- Drops in metrics like accuracy, F1 score, or RMSE.
- Shifts in data distribution statistics.
- Human review flags or discrepancies in predictions.
By setting thresholds on these metrics, retraining can be automated, ensuring timely responses before the model’s reliability slips.
Best Practices in Model Retraining
For retraining to be effective and scalable, a structured approach is crucial. Some practices that organizations often adopt include:
- Track multiple triggers to capture a wider variety of data changes.
- Retrain asynchronously to avoid unnecessary delays and ensure quick updates.
- Test in staging environments before deploying retrained models into production.
- Keep dataset snapshots so retraining can be replicated or revisited if needed.
- Validate thoroughly to confirm the stability and generalization of new models.
- Automate workflows to reduce human error and speed up the process.
Why Retraining Matters in MLOps
Regular retraining acts as the backbone of dependable machine learning systems. By updating models with the latest insights and patterns, organizations can keep them aligned with real-world changes. This adaptability ensures that models remain useful, trustworthy, and ready for the challenges ahead.
Final Thoughts
Model retraining is more than just a maintenance task—it is a strategic element of MLOps that directly impacts accuracy, resilience, and long-term success. By embracing proactive retraining strategies and applying consistent best practices, organizations can safeguard their machine learning models against performance decline and keep them future-ready.
wabdewleapraninub